About 39a
39a is a four-bedroom detached house in Astwood, Newport Pagnell, Newport Pagnell (MK16 9JS). It has a recorded floor area of 122 m² (around 1313 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(July 2025) shows a C (score 78),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in September 2010 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and main heating went from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).
At 122 m² it's 20.3%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(153 m² median across 22 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 82%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£559,000 is 48.3% above the 2011 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£287/sq ft) was about 30.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 15 years since the last transfer (July 2011).
